A locksmith can replace your car keys in the event that you lose them. The cost is usually between $50 and $100. Depending on the kind of car key and its electronic features, the price could be higher. For example replacing a damaged home key could cost as much as $100, while getting the new car key that comes with a transponder chip may cost as high as $400. You can also hire a locksmith to create an original car key.

It is vital to check the license and business card of a locksmith prior to hiring them. In nine states, 24-hour locksmith locksmiths are required to have a license. To ensure they're authentic, you may want to check their online presence or read testimonials from previous customers. Always ask for a price before hiring someone and never sign a blank invoice. Ask the person about their experience and whether they've had similar experiences.
